IMG 9774-001-Washing Line Finial


Sidney Estate (social housing), opened in 1938 in Somers Town. The decorative ceramics are by sculptor Gilbert Bayes. The lunettes above balconies are made of Doulton stoneware and depict scenes from fairy tales. The finials on the top of washing line poles (also Doulton stoneware) are sailing ships.
